New York Post ‘Doctor Strange’ Review

New York Post

With a mischievous, metaphysical flourish, “Doctor Strange” administers some much-needed CPR to the flagging superhero genre. It doesn’t reinvent the wheel — a power-hungry villain (Mads Mikkelsen) tries to unleash hell on Earth, blah blah blah — but it’s a heck of a lot more fun than I’ve had at a Marvel movie lately. Plus, who could be more perfectly suited to the moniker than Benedict Cumberbatch, who’s always exuded strangeness?
